Teaching tips for The Forest
- 1Encourage students to share local examples of forests they have visited or know about.
- 2Organize a field trip to a nearby forest area to observe the ecosystem firsthand.
- 3Discuss the role of local communities in forest conservation, referencing the Chipko Movement as a case study.
Board exam relevance
Questions may include MCQs on key terms, short answer questions about the importance of forests in India, and source-based questions analyzing case studies like the Chipko Movement.
